I recently mentioned a way to run multiple Explorers on one PC without rebooting. Here's another resource for people testing their websites: iCapture is a site which shows PC- or OS9-based authors what their site looks like on Safari 1.2. You have to wait 30 seconds or so for the request to be fulfilled. All VR sites I tried seem to work (in terms of displaying the VR content as well as the page design).
